Patric Gösta Hörnqvist (born January 1, 1987 in Sollentuna ) is a Swedish ice hockey player who has been under contract with the Pittsburgh Penguins in the National Hockey League since June 2014 . With the team, the right winger won the Stanley Cup in the 2016 and 2017 playoffs . With the Swedish national team , he also won the gold medal at the 2018 World Cup .
Career
Patric Hörnqvist was selected in the NHL Entry Draft 2005 in the seventh round as a total of 230th player by the Nashville Predators . He then played for Djurgårdens IF in his Swedish homeland for three years . In these three seasons he got 72 scorer points in 154 games, including 46 goals.
In the summer of 2008, the winger was added to the Predators' NHL squad. He scored his first goal in the National Hockey League on October 15, 2008 against the Dallas Stars . After a short time, the Swede - due to mixed performance - was ordered into the squad of Nashville's farm team , the Milwaukee Admirals from the American Hockey League . In the 2009/10 season he made his breakthrough in Nashville, when Hörnqvist was on the ice in 80 NHL regular season games and scored 51 points. So he was together with Steve Sullivan the best scorer of the Predators.
For the duration of the NHL lockout in the 2012/13 season, the striker was signed by the Swiss club HC Red Ice in October 2012 .
In June 2014 he moved to the Pittsburgh Penguins , with whom he won the Stanley Cup in the 2016 playoffs . In 2017 he managed to defend his title with the team, in the sixth game of the playoff final against the Nashville Predators he scored the decisive goal to win the trophy in the 59th minute. In February 2018, Hörnqvist signed a new contract in Pittsburgh that is expected to earn him an average annual salary of $ 5.3 million over the next five seasons.
Achievements and Awards
- 2007 Swedish U20 junior runner-up with Djurgårdens IF
- 2007 Årets nykomling
- 2016 Stanley Cup win with the Pittsburgh Penguins
- 2017 Stanley Cup win with the Pittsburgh Penguins
International
- 2005 bronze medal at the U18 Junior World Championship
- 2016 third place at the World Cup of Hockey
- 2018 gold medal at the world championship
